Here are some events coming up at Chimney Rock State Park in Chimney Rock, NC.
Off the Beaten Path Guided Hike Saturday, March 28: 9-20am; $20, $5 for Annual Passholder, $10 for ages 6-15, $3 for Grady's Kids Club Members. Use your sense of smell to sleuth your way into recognition of our aromatic plant neighbors of field and forest. With so many sap smells out there, participants will learn through the nose many of these silently smelly plants. Natural history and herbal uses go along with the interpretation on this easy 1 1/2 hours walk.
54th Annual Easter Sunrise Service - April 12th; Gates open at 5am and close at 6am for the 6:30am service. No fees charged. Guests are welcome to enjoy the Park for the day. Celebrate the glory of Easter as our guest at this nondenominational community worship. This special service will be filled with song, scripture, special music and spectacular sunrise views over beautiful Lake Lure and Hickory Nut Gorge. Arrive early and dress warmly and bring a flashlight.

5th Annual Bark in the Park - April 18th; 11am-3pm; No additional cost with Park admission. All ages. Chimney Rock goes to the dogs for this special event dedicated to our canine companions. Agiltiy demonstrations, rescue organizations, contests and lots more will keep ou and your pup busy.
Early Arrivals "Simon Says" Guided Bird Walk - April 19th; $19; $3 for Annual Passholders; $8 for ages 6-15; free for Grady's Kids Club Members. Spot spring migrants like Black-throated Warblers, Black and white Warblers, Scarlet Tanagers and Blue-headed Vireos. World-traveled ornithologist and birding expert Simon Thompson is your guide on this easy-to moderate walk.
Wildflower Wonders "Off the Beaten Path" Guided Hike - April 25th; 9-10:30am Cost: 420, $5 for Annual Passholders, $10 for ages 6-15, $3 for Grady's Kids Club Members. Ages: 8 and up. See the diversity of wildflowers at this time of year by taking an interpretive botanical walk into Chimney Rock's rich woodlands. Carry your favorite guide book or come prepared with paper, memory or mere hungry eyes to enjoy this easy 1 1/2 hour show-and -tell stroll.
